A Photo Illustration Of The Barclays Bank Website
A Photo Illustration Of The Barclays Bank Website
Size: 3872px × 2592px
Location: London United Kingdom
Photo credit: © Pixhall /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: bank, banking, barclays, cats, crisis, debt, economic, fat, illustration, internet, log, login, online, personal, photo, profits, recession, website